Most free PDFs floating around are scans of the 15th, 17th, or 19th editions. As of 2025, the relevant edition is likely the 24th or 25th. Forensic medicine changes rapidly: - New poisons emerge (e.g., novel synthetic opioids). - Legal sections change (e.g., amendments to the IPC regarding rape or medical termination of pregnancy). - NCRB data is updated. A free PDF of an old edition will contain outdated laws and toxicological data, causing you to lose marks on an exam or, worse, give wrong medico-legal advice.

The Author and His Legacy
Dr. V.V. Pillay is a prominent figure in the landscape of Indian forensic medicine. His work is characterized by a pragmatic approach that bridges the gap between theoretical medical science and the practical realities of the Indian legal system. Unlike some Western textbooks that focus heavily on jurisprudence alien to the Indian context, Dr. Pillay’s writing is deeply rooted in Indian law—specifically the Indian Penal Code (IPC), the Code of Criminal Procedure (CrPC), and the Indian Evidence Act. This localization makes the book an indispensable tool for students preparing for examinations and professionals navigating the medico-legal system in India.
Scope and Content
The textbook is broadly divided into three main sections: Forensic Medicine, Clinical Forensic Medicine, and Toxicology.
The first section, Forensic Medicine, deals with the core principles of medical jurisprudence. It covers the definition and scope of the field, the medical profession’s ethical duties, and the concept of medical negligence. A significant portion of the text is dedicated to thanatology—the study of death. Dr. Pillay provides detailed explanations of the signs of death, changes that occur in the body after death (such as algor mortis, livor mortis, and rigor mortis), and the crucial process of estimating the post-mortem interval (PMI).
The second section focuses on Clinical Forensic Medicine. This includes trauma and injuries, which are critical for medical officers examining assault victims or accident cases. The text meticulously classifies wounds, burns, and firearms injuries, offering clear guidelines on how to document these findings for legal purposes. Furthermore, the book addresses sensitive and complex topics such as sexual offenses, virginity, pregnancy, and delivery, providing medical students with the necessary vocabulary and procedural knowledge to handle such cases with legal precision.
The third major pillar of the book is Toxicology. This section is often cited as one of the most student-friendly aspects of the text. It categorizes poisons based on their origin and mechanism of action—corrosives, irritants, neurotics, and cardiac poisons. For each category, Dr. Pillay outlines the physical properties of the poison, its clinical symptoms, the fatal dose, and the post-mortem appearances. Notably, the book includes specific chapters on alcohol and drug dependence, reflecting modern societal challenges. The inclusion of charts and tables for the diagnosis and treatment of poisoning makes it a quick reference guide for emergency room physicians.

The Digital Context: The Search for the PDF
The prevalence of the search term "VV Pillay forensic medicine PDF" underscores a shift in how modern students access information. While the convenience of digital formats allows for easy portability and searchability, reliance on unauthorized PDFs can have drawbacks. These versions may lack the high-resolution images necessary for identifying wound patterns or histological slides, and they may contain outdated information if they are not the latest edition. Publishers regularly update forensic texts to reflect amendments in the law (such as recent changes in criminal laws in India) and new toxicological trends; therefore, relying on an older, static PDF can be detrimental to a student's knowledge base.
